What are suprema and infima of a set? This is an important concept in real analysis, we'll be defining both terms today with supremum examples and infimum examples to help make it clear! In short, a supremum of a set is a least upper bound. An infimum is a greatest lower bound. It is easily proven that we can refer to "the supremum" and "the infimum" of a set because if they exist they are unique.

How is 1 the greatest lower bound of the natural numbers? The logic used to make one the greatest lower bound would also make 2 the greatest lower bound.
@WrathofMath
@WrathofMath 2 жыл бұрын
1 is the greatest lower bound of the naturals because a) 1 is a lower bound of the naturals, there is no natural number less than 1 b) there is no lower bound of the naturals greater than 1, we know this because any number x greater than 1 couldn't be a lower bound of the naturals, since 1 (a natural) is less than x. For example, 2 is not the greatest lower bound of the naturals since it is not a lower bound at all, the natural number 1 is less than it.
@kaos092
@kaos092 2 жыл бұрын
@@WrathofMath Are you basically saying 0 isn't a natural number?
@WrathofMath
@WrathofMath 2 жыл бұрын
Yes. If you include 0 as a natural, then it would be the infimum.
